def __init__(self, project_id, version_id, model, dimension): ''' Constructor ''' VM_HighChart.__init__(IssuePropertyChart, project_id, version_id) self.dimension = dimension self.property_model = model self.xaxis = self.chart_xaxis(self) self.yaxis = self.chart_yaxis(self) self.yaxis_title = "" self.tooltip = self.chart_tooltip(self)
def __init__(self, project_id, version_id): ''' Constructor ''' VM_HighChart.__init__(VM_PieChart, project_id, version_id) self.chart_id = 0 self.project_id = project_id self.version_id = version_id self.chart_type = 'pie' self.show_legend = True self.series_name = '' self.series_data = list()
def __init__(self, project_id, version_id, date_range=30): ''' Constructor ''' VM_HighChart.__init__(UnClosedIssueColumnChart, project_id, version_id) self.chart_id = 1 self.chart_type = "column" self.chart_title = "剩余问题分布" self.chart_sub_title = "剩余问题人员分布" self.xaxis = self.chart_xaxis() self.yaxis = self.chart_yaxis() self.yaxis_title = "" self.tooltip = self.chart_tooltip() self.series_data = self.series()
def __init__(self, project_id, version_id, date_range=30): ''' Constructor ''' VM_HighChart.__init__(TotalIssueTrendChart, project_id, version_id) self.chart_id = 1 self.chart_type = "area" self.chart_title = "问题数量" self.chart_sub_title = "总体趋势" self.xaxis = self.chart_xaxis() self.yaxis = self.chart_yaxis() self.yaxis_title = "" self.tooltip = self.chart_tooltip() self.series_data = self.series()
def __init__(self,project_id,version_id,date_range=30): ''' Constructor ''' VM_HighChart.__init__(NewIssueTrendChart,project_id, version_id) self.chart_id=1 self.chart_type="spline" self.chart_title="新增及解决问题趋势" self.chart_sub_title="每日趋势" self.xaxis=self.chart_xaxis() self.yaxis=self.chart_yaxis() self.yaxis_title="" self.tooltip=self.chart_tooltip() self.series_data=self.series()
def __init__(self, project_id, version_id, date_range=30): ''' Constructor ''' VM_HighChart.__init__(ModuleIssueColumnChart, project_id, version_id) self.chart_id = 1 self.chart_type = "column" self.chart_title = "各模块问题分布" self.chart_sub_title = "问题在各个模块比例" self.date_range = date_range self.xaxis = self.chart_xaxis() self.yaxis = self.chart_yaxis() self.yaxis_title = "" self.tooltip = self.chart_tooltip() self.series_data = self.series()